CM's legal aid to ministers gave rise to speculations

Rumours are rife that the chief minister Kiran Kumar Reddy is soon going to quit Congress party and join YSRC led by Jaganmohan Reddy. According to the rumours, the analysts opined that Kiran Kumar Reddy is giving legal aid to ministers who are under fault for issuing 26 controversial GOs. Hence, they stated that Kiran wanted to protect Jaganmohan Reddy and all this apparently indicates that Kiran would soon join YSR Congress party.

Also, there's are rumours that Kiran Kumar Reddy was insecured about his chief minister's post as he feels threat from Congress MP Chiranjeevi, who is most likely to become the next chief minister of the state. However, Congress sources ruled out this news and called it baseless. The Congress sources said Kiran Kumar Reddy would have saved minister Mopidevi if he had such thoughts.
